## Root Transliteration (Phonetic Spelling)
- oligopsuchos (ol-ig-op'-soo-khos)
---
## Strong's Definition & Usage
- Definition: fainthearted
- Usage: faint-hearted, of small courage
---
## Part of Speech
- Adjective

## Helps Word Studies
- [[G3642]] oligópsyxos (from [[G3641]] /olígos, "little in quantity" and [[G5590]]/psyxē, "soul") – properly, an undeveloped soul, lacking in personhood (without a healthy identity, developed individuality).
